1. Product Introduction & Main Application

Arnico’s Vinyl Chloride Monomer (VCM) is a colorless gas with a sweet, ethereal odor, which is liquefied under pressure and produced by the thermal cracking of Ethylene Dichloride (EDC). This exclusive chemical intermediate is the primary and irreplaceable monomer for the production of Polyvinyl Chloride (PVC), which, after polyethylene and polypropylene, is the third most-used plastic in the world.

2. Technical Specifications

Technical Parameter Suspension PVC Grade (S-PVC) Copolymer Grade Unit
Purity ≥ 99.98 ≥ 99.95 %
Acetylene ≤ 2 ≤ 5 ppm
Acidity (as HCl) ≤ 1 ≤ 2 ppm
Iron (Fe) ≤ 0.5 ≤ 1.0 ppm
Water ≤ 50 ≤ 100 ppm
Inhibitor (HQ/MEHQ) Upon request Upon request ppm
Liquid Density (20°C) 0.910 – 0.915 0.910 – 0.915 g/cm³

3. Features & Benefits

  • Exceptional Polymer Purity: Acetylene, a deadly poison for the radical polymerization of PVC that reduces molecular weight and thermal stability, is at a near-zero level.

  • Controlled Polymerization Reaction: Enables the production of PVC granulate with precisely controlled porosity, molecular weight, and particle size distribution.

  • A Versatile Plastic Raw Material: Conversion into products ranging from rigid underground pipes to soft flooring and flexible cables.

  • Stability in Storage: The addition of an inhibitor prevents spontaneous polymerization.

4. Industrial Applications

  • PVC Production: > 98% of the world’s VCM is used to produce polyvinyl chloride via suspension, emulsion, and mass polymerization methods.

  • Copolymer Production: Vinyl chloride-vinyl acetate copolymers for floor coatings.

  • Chlorinated Solvents: A raw material for the synthesis of trichloroethylene and perchloroethylene.

5. Safety & Handling

  • MSDS (Material Safety Data Sheet): This gas is extremely flammable, explosive, and a confirmed human carcinogen (IARC Group 1). The Arnico MSDS is vital for safe handling.

  • Storage Conditions: Store in pressurized and refrigerated spherical tanks, in an environment completely away from oxygen, sparks, and heat.

  • Personal Protective Equipment (PPE): Level A full personal protective equipment, an SCBA respirator, and continuous environmental monitoring are required.
